Carney complex in association with atrial myxoma: Case report [Atriyal Miksoma ile Birlikte Carney Kompleksi]
Abstract
Carney complex is an autosomal dominantly inherited disease complex including myxomas, pigmented skin lesions and endocrine neoplasias. It was first defined by J. Aidan Carney in 1985. Myxomas can be observed in the heart, skin and breast. Familial myxomas were seen at younger ages than sporadic forms. The most common endocrine gland manifestations acromegaly, thyroid and testicular tumors, and adrenocorticotropic hormone-independent Cushing's syndrome. A cardiac myxoma requires surgical removal. In this study, we present a case of left atrial myx-oma with Carney syndrome who was early diagnosed and successfully treated with surgery. Copyright © 2013 by Türkiye Klinikleri.
